This topic is probably far to general, but what the heck.

Since Flight Simulator 2002 is slowly getting older, its price dropped more than 50 %, so i think of buying it. At the moment, I only have FS 98, and compared with FS 2002, its extremely old. Can anybody here of you tell me if the following things are true? 9so its really worth buiyng it?)

1) The airports are much more detailed, and they contain much more airplaqnes driving around, taking off and landing (this my most important point to buy it. The situation in FS 98 is really getting irritating. For example: Schiphol, one of the worlds largest international airports, were every day more than 150 airplanes take of and land, is completely empty! not one airplane to be seen in FS 98! imagine O'hare international airport completely empty. is that realistic?).

2) Planes are more detailed and there are many sorts of airplanes driving around (in FS 98, O'Hare international has only ne type of airplane riving around, in lots of colors. Actually, that is quite stupid.)

3) the terrain contains more (detailed) houses.

4) the hole interface is nicer and better made. cockpits are more realistic, and more flyable airplanes have a 3D view.

that's about it I think. Are most of these (certainly point 1) true?

quote:
Originally written by JadeWolf:

Are flight sims for learning how to fly a plane or for the fun of pretending to fly one?
Flight sims are for people who don't have the money to fly, are not pilots, never have a chance at flying cool aircraft, and/or are physically incapable of getting off their computer.

They can be useful for learning how to fly, though to really be effective they need to be coupled with proper input equipment. In real planes, no one controls them with a keyboard. :P

Basically, they're just for fun though. You know, being able to take a 737 loaded with people and crash it in downtown Chicago while executing as many barrel rolls as possible on the way down.
